Sinopsis de SHADOWS & LIGHT

"Until the lion tells the story, the hunter will always be the hero."

At thirty-two, wildlife photographer Cassie Eskelson has perfected her exit strategy, leaving every relationship before the walls close in. Labeled "unstable" by her family and "broken" by a string of exes, she has spent her adult life behind the lens, where the world is manageable one frame at a time.

But when she breaks into her deceased fathers home in Albuquerque, New Mexico, she triggers a war with her half-brother Kevin—a politically ambitious lawyer who treats her as a problem to be managed. To him, the house is an asset. To Cassie, its the last place she saw her mother alive.

When Detective Kai Mitchell enters her life, he doesnt try to fix her or explain her to herself. He simply doesnt flinch. And for a woman who has built her life around leaving before she can be left, thats the most disorienting thing of all.

As the desert light strips away thirty years of gaslighting and family silence, Cassie must decide whether to build one last exit—or stop running long enough to see the truth thats been buried in plain sight.

A novel of trauma, attachment, and the merciless clarity of truth, Shadows & Light is Upmarket Womens Fiction with a Southwestern Gothic edge — for readers who loved Where the Crawdads Sing, The Great Alone, and Ask Again, Yes.
